Introduction of the author

 

ASAKURA, Naomi was born in 1929, and graduated from the Department of Arts of the Tokyo University of Education with a major in KOHSEI (Basic Art & Design). He worked as a graphic designer, then became an assistant professor of the Kyoto University of Education, assistant professor of the Tokyo University of Education, and professor of Tsukuba University. Currently, he is a professor of Bunkyo University, and serves as the president of the Basic Art and Design Society, and an honorary member and a steering committee member of the Japan Society for the Science of Design. He also serves as a temporary lecturer at the graduate school of the Women's University of Arts, an honorary professor at the Guangzhou University of Arts (China), an honorary professor of the Shantdong University of Art and Design (China), and a visiting professor of the Tienchin University of Arts (China).
